I was court-ordered to complete drug testing, can I do that with Community Corrections?

In most cases, yes. Please have your attorney, probation officer, or case worker contact Community Corrections to set up your testing.
Clients doing testing for an outside agency are required to pay for the cost of their testing, at each test or in advance. The typical cost is $5 for a drug screen and breathalyzer test. Any additional laboratory or testing fees will be assessed to the client. Cash and money order payments are accepted in the testing area. The front lobby can accept card payments, for an additional fee.
